Transaction 95b85705f1fdeaa37e6f67f0245583779b970a2e7f00da381e69427af7616088

1 Input
2 Outputs
  • 95b85705f1fdeaa37e6f67f0245583779b970a2e7f00da381e69427af7616088:0
  • value  2070000
    address  33BWpJJcuLr2UJ3Ph9GCeCsTWsg9MArEpF
  • 95b85705f1fdeaa37e6f67f0245583779b970a2e7f00da381e69427af7616088:1
  • value  177917680
    address  1QMW9BUV6VXVTCGPFtLEDSiS6BxEatQ4M